  6. 24 de may. de 2024 · Great Society refers to a set of government policy initiatives that were created in the 1960s by President Lyndon B. Johnson. In just under five years in the 1960s, Lyndon B. Johnson enacted nearly 200 pieces of legislation known as the Great Society, aiming to eliminate poverty and racial injustice in America.

  7. 19 de may. de 2024 · The Royal Society originated on November 28, 1660, when 12 men met after a lecture at Gresham College, London, by Christopher Wren (then professor of astronomy at the college) and resolved to set up “a Colledge for the promoting of Physico-Mathematicall Experimentall Learning.”
